Abstract

The utility model discloses a kind of data acquisition device based on LORA wireless technologys, including:Single-chip microcomputer, sensor module, LORA wireless modules, RFID label tag, alarm, host computer, handheld terminal, single-chip microcomputer and sensor module, LORA wireless modules, alarm are electrically connected with, single-chip microcomputer is by LORA wireless modules and host computer radio communication, host computer and handheld terminal radio communication;Microprocessor and communication device, RFID reader, touch display screen, electronic multimeter, the distress signal emitter of handheld terminal are electrically connected with.Beneficial effect:Host computer is wirelessly transmitted to using a variety of instrument or Sensor monitoring environmental data and by LORA wireless modules, realizes the wireless collection of a variety of environmental datas, improves the efficiency and convenience of data acquisition, more easily monitoring device running status;Attendant can significantly facilitate the plant maintenance after monitoring environmental data exception using handheld terminal.

Embodiment
In order that the purpose of this utility model, technical scheme and advantage are more clearly understood, below in conjunction with accompanying drawing and implementation Example, the utility model is further elaborated.It should be appreciated that specific embodiment described herein is only explaining The utility model, it is not used to limit the utility model.
The utility model provides a kind of data acquisition device based on LORA wireless technologys, including:Single-chip microcomputer 1, sensing Device module 2, LORA wireless modules 5, RFID label tag 7, alarm 6, host computer 8, handheld terminal 9, single-chip microcomputer 1 and sensor die Group 2, LORA wireless modules 5, alarm 6 are electrically connected with, single-chip microcomputer 1 by LORA wireless modules 5 and the radio communication of host computer 8, Host computer 8 and the radio communication of handheld terminal 9;Sensor module 2 include temperature sensor, humidity sensor, current sensor, Voltage sensor, liquid level sensor, Smoke Sensor, water sensor, hydraulic pressure sensor, handheld terminal 9 include microprocessor Device 91, communication device 94, RFID reader 92, touch display screen 93, electronic multimeter 96, distress signal emitter 95, it is micro- Processor 91 and communication device 94, RFID reader 92, touch display screen 93, electronic multimeter 96, distress signal emitter 95 are electrically connected with.
In above-mentioned technical proposal, the data acquisition device provided by the utility model based on LORA wireless technologys also includes single Phase voltameter 31, three-phase voltameter 32, single-chip microcomputer 1 are provided with RS485 ports 3, and single-phase voltameter 31 passes through with three-phase voltameter 32 RS485 ports 3 are connected with single-chip microcomputer 1, and other have sensor/instrument/instrument of RS485 ports 3 can also be by RS485 ends Mouth 3 is connected with single-chip microcomputer 1.
In above-mentioned technical proposal, single-chip microcomputer 1 is provided with a TTL ports 4, some analog input interfaces, some numeral letters Number input interface, the sensor that sensor module 2 includes pass through analog input interface or data signal input interface and list Piece machine 1 connects;Preferably, single-chip microcomputer 1 is provided with 16 analog input interfaces and 8 digital signal input interfaces, i.e. monolithic Machine 1 can connect sensor of 16 outputs for analog quantity, can connect 8 outputs as the sensor of digital quantity, TTL ports 4 Available for upgrading or debug the pre-set programs in single-chip microcomputer 1.
In above-mentioned technical proposal, in addition to a LED display 13, a power supply 12, one alarm stop button 10, a GPS moulds Block 11, single-chip microcomputer 1 are electrically connected with LED display 13, power supply 12, alarm stop button 10, GPS module 11.
Preferably, LORA wireless modules 5 use F8L10D-E-433-NS-U models, and single-chip microcomputer 1 uses C08051F040 types Number;Preferably, host computer 8 can also connect a short message cloud platform, and short message cloud platform is used in equipment fault to attendant Sending short message by mobile phone.
The present invention the data acquisition device based on LORA wireless technologys in use, analog input interface, Data signal input interface, RS485 ports 3 connect sensor module 2, single-phase voltameter 31, three-phase voltameter 32 or other Instrument/Sensor monitoring environmental data, and the environmental data of monitoring is sent to single-chip microcomputer 1, the processing environment data of single-chip microcomputer 1 are simultaneously Environmental data after processing is sent to host computer 8 by LORA wireless modules 5, host computer 8 judges whether environmental data is normal, When environmental data is abnormal, alert notice is sent to handheld terminal 9, while alarm signal is sent by LORA wireless modules 5 Number to single-chip microcomputer 1, after single-chip microcomputer 1 receives alarm signal, control alarm 6 is alarmed;Attendant has found the hand-held of oneself After the display alarm of touch display screen 93 notice of terminal 9, to appointed place, (GPS module 11 provides the position of data acquisition device Information, positional information are sent to host computer 8, and the alert notice comprising positional information is sent to handheld terminal 9 by host computer 8) Carry out plant maintenance;Attendant can press the alarm stop button 10 of data acquisition device, and alarm stop button 10 sends electricity Signal controls the stop alarm of alarm 6 to single-chip microcomputer 1, single-chip microcomputer 1;The handheld terminal 9 of attendant is close to single-chip microcomputer 1 When (RFID label tag 7 be arranged at the surface of single-chip microcomputer 1 or near), the RFID reader 92 of handheld terminal 9 reads RFID label tag 7 Memory storage information (the unit type information of the data storage harvester of RFID label tag 7, sensor module 2, instrument monitoring it is each Unit type, monitoring positional information etc.) and by the presentation of information of reading to touch display screen 93, so that attendant is according to relevant Information carries out plant maintenance;Data acquisition device is also integrated with electronic multimeter 96, and the data that electronic multimeter 96 measures can be with Shown in touch display screen 93, the personnel that maintain easily safeguard, detection device;Attendant can pass through communication device 94 and other dimensions Shield personnel or exchange are communicated, and when maintained equipment is caused danger, can be operated distress signal by touch display screen 93 and be sent out Injection device 95 sends distress signal.
